https://www.podbean.com/media/share/pb-57a7c-1756f8f
Today we look at Paul’s teaching on two gifts: Tongues and Prophecy. Though these gifts are often misunderstood, misapplied or confusing, just as they were in the first century, the Bible gives us clarity about what these gifts are and how to walk in them.
We must remember that these gifts are not the “meat of the hamburger.” Love is the most excellent way.
“For anyone who speaks in a tongue does not speak to men but to God. Indeed, no one understands him; he utters mysteries with his spirit. But everyone who prophesies speaks to men for their strengthening, encouragement and comfort. He who speaks in a tongue edifies himself, but he who prophesies edifies the church. I would like every one of you to speak in tongues, but I would rather have you prophesy. He who prophesies is greater than one who speaks in tongues, unless he interprets, so that the church may be edified.”

Today we look a very important part of this Spiritual Hamburger: the lists of spiritual gifts that Paul gives in his letters — what are they, how do we get them, and why they are given. They are:
1. Prophecy (4x)
2. Teaching (3x)
3. Speaking in different kinds of tongues (2x)
4. Healing (2X)
5. Interpretation of tongues
6. Message (Word) of wisdom
7. Message (Word) of knowledge
8. Faith
9. Miraculous powers
10. Distinguishing between spirits
11. Apostolic
12. Evangelistic
13. Pastoral
14. Workers of Miracles
15. Helping others
16. Administration
17. Service
18. Encouraging/Exhortation
19. Contributing to the needs of others
20. Leading
21. Acting in Mercy
